@font-face { font-family: gunplay_rg; src: url('fonts/gunplay_rg.ttf'); } span.font { color: #394B82; } .cov { display: block; text-align: center; margin-top: 0%; margin-bottom: 0%; } img { max-width: 100%; max-height: 100%; width: auto; } .ic { display: inline; font-size: 5em; line-height: .8em; color: #A0A0A0; float: left; } a { text-decoration: none; } .copy { display: block; font-size: x-small; text-indent: 0%; margin-top: 0%; margin-bottom: 0%; } .copy1 { display: block; text-indent: 0%; font-size: x-small; margin-top: 2%; margin-bottom: 0%; } .copy2 { display: block; text-indent: 0%; font-size: x-small; margin-left: 5%; margin-bottom: 0%; margin-top: 0%; } .fm { display: block; font-size: 8em; text-indent: 0%; text-align: center; color: #A0A0A0; margin-top: 15%; font-weight: bold; margin-bottom: 0%; } .ded { display: block; font-size: medium; text-indent: 0%; text-align: center; margin-top: 15%; margin-bottom: 0%; } .toc-ttl { display: block; font-size: x-large; text-indent: 0%; text-align: left; margin-top: 8%; font-weight: bold; margin-bottom: 4%; } .toc-ttl1 { display: block; font-size: large; text-indent: 0%; text-align: left; margin-top: 8%; font-weight: bold; margin-bottom: 4%; color: #394B8B; } .toc-tx1 { display: block; font-size: medium; margin-left: 0%; margin-top: 0%; margin-bottom: 0%; } .toc-tx2 { display: block; font-size: small; margin-left: 0%; margin-top: 1%; margin-bottom: 0%; } .ttl { display: block; font-size: 1.5em; margin-left: 0%; text-align: left; margin-top: 10%; font-weight: bold; margin-bottom: 8%; } .toc-tx2a { display: block; font-size: large; text-indent: 0%; margin-top: 2%; margin-bottom: 0%; } .toc-tx4 { display: block; font-size: small; text-indent: -10%; margin-top: 0%; margin-bottom: 3%; } .toc { display: block; font-size: small; text-indent: 0%; margin-top: 0%; margin-bottom: 0%; } .toc1 { display: block; font-size: medium; text-indent: 0%; margin-top: 2%; margin-bottom: 0%; border-bottom: 1pt solid black; } .toc2 { display: block; font-size: small; text-indent: 0%; margin-top: 0.5%; margin-bottom: 0%; border-bottom: 1pt solid black; } .ch-toc { display: block; font-size: small; text-indent: 0%; margin-top: 1%; margin-bottom: 0%; font-weight: bold; } .ch-toc1 { display: block; font-size: small; text-indent: 0%; margin-top: 0%; margin-bottom: 0%; margin-left: 2%; font-weight: bold; } .box { border: 1px solid black; text-align: left; width: auto; margin-top: 10%; margin-right: 70%; padding-top: 10px; padding-right: 5px; padding-left: 5px; padding-bottom: 10px; margin-bottom: 6%; } .chap1 { display: block; font-weight: bold; font-size: x-large; text-indent: 0%; margin-top: 10%; margin-bottom: 4%; } .chap-num { display: block; font-weight: bold; font-size: xx-large; text-align: center; margin-top: 8%; margin-bottom: 8%; } .chap-ttl { display: block; font-size: large; text-align: left; margin-top: 4%; margin-left: 0%; margin-bottom: 1%; } .chap-ttl1 { display: block; font-weight: bold; font-size: medium; text-align: left; margin-top: 0%; margin-bottom: 8%; } .chap-ttl2 { display: block; font-weight: bold; font-size: medium; text-align: center; margin-top: 4%; margin-bottom: 2%; } .img { display: block; text-align: center; font-size: small; margin-top: 0%; margin-bottom: 3%; } .ser { display: block; text-align: center; font-size: small; margin-top: 1%; margin-bottom: 1%; } .ser-medium { display: block; text-align: center; font-size: medium; margin-top: 0%; margin-bottom: 5%; } .ser-large { display: block; text-align: center; font-size: large; margin-top: 0%; margin-bottom: 0%; } .ser-x-large { display: block; text-align: center; font-size: x-large; margin-top: 0%; margin-bottom: 0%; } .ser-xx-large { display: block; text-align: center; font-size: xx-large; margin-top: 0%; margin-bottom: 0%; } .ser1 { display: block; text-align: center; font-size: small; margin-top: 2%; margin-bottom: 2%; } .ser1-medium { display: block; text-align: center; font-size: medium; margin-top: 2%; margin-bottom: 2%; } .ser1-large { display: block; text-align: center; font-size: large; margin-top: 2%; margin-bottom: 2%; } .ser1-x-large { display: block; text-align: center; font-size: x-large; margin-top: 2%; margin-bottom: 2%; } .ser1-xx-large { display: block; text-align: center; font-size: xx-large; margin-top: 2%; margin-bottom: 2%; } .ser2 { display: block; text-align: center; font-size: small; margin-top: 2%; margin-bottom: 0%; } .ser2-medium { display: block; text-align: center; font-size: medium; margin-top: 2%; margin-bottom: 0%; } .ser2-large { display: block; text-align: center; font-size: large; margin-top: 2%; margin-bottom: 0%; } .ser2-x-large { display: block; text-align: center; font-size: x-large; margin-top: 2%; margin-bottom: 0%; } .ser2-xx-large { display: block; text-align: center; font-size: xx-large; margin-top: 2%; margin-bottom: 0%; } .ser3 { display: block; text-align: center; font-size: small; margin-top: 0%; margin-bottom: 2%; } .ser3-medium { display: block; text-align: center; font-size: medium; margin-top: 0%; margin-bottom: 2%; } .ser3-large { display: block; text-align: center; font-size: large; margin-top: 0%; margin-bottom: 2%; } .ser3-x-large { display: block; text-align: center; font-size: x-large; margin-top: 0%; margin-bottom: 2%; } .ser3-xx-large { display: block; text-align: center; font-size: xx-large; margin-top: 0%; margin-bottom: 2%; } .tx1 { display: block; font-size: small; text-indent: 0%; margin-top: 0%; margin-bottom: 0%; } .tx1a { display: block; font-size: small; text-indent: 0%; margin-top: 0%; margin-bottom: 0%; margin-left: 2%; } .tx1-medium { display: block; font-size: medium; text-indent: 0%; margin-top: 0%; margin-bottom: 0%; } .tx1-large { display: block; font-size: large; text-indent: 0%; margin-top: 0%; margin-bottom: 0%; } .tx1-x-large { display: block; font-size: x-large; text-indent: 0%; margin-top: 0%; margin-bottom: 0%; } .tx1-xx-large { display: block; font-size: xx-large; text-indent: 0%; margin-top: 0%; margin-bottom: 0%; } .tx2 { display: block; font-size: small; text-indent: 0%; margin-top: 2%; margin-bottom: 0%; } .tx2a { display: block; font-size: small; text-indent: 0%; margin-top: 2%; margin-bottom: 0%; margin-left: 2%; } .tx2b { display: block; font-size: small; text-indent: 0%; margin-top: 4%; margin-bottom: 0%; } .tx2-medium { display: block; font-size: medium; text-indent: 0%; margin-top: 2%; margin-bottom: 0%; } .tx2-large { display: block; font-size: large; text-indent: 0%; margin-top: 2%; margin-bottom: 0%; } .tx2-x-large { display: block; font-size: x-large; text-indent: 0%; margin-top: 2%; margin-bottom: 0%; } .tx2-xx-large { display: block; font-size: xx-large; text-indent: 0%; margin-top: 2%; margin-bottom: 0%; } .tx3 { display: block; font-size: small; text-indent: 5%; margin-top: 2%; margin-bottom: 0%; } .color { display: inline; text-indent: 0%; margin-top: 0%; color: #A0A0A0; margin-bottom: 0%; } .tx3-large { display: block; font-size: large; text-indent: 0%; margin-top: 0%; margin-bottom: 2%; } .tx3-x-large { display: block; font-size: x-large; text-indent: 0%; margin-top: 0%; margin-bottom: 2%; } .tx3-xx-large { display: block; font-size: xx-large; text-indent: 0%; margin-top: 0%; margin-bottom: 2%; } .tx4 { display: block; font-size: small; text-indent: 0%; margin-top: 2%; margin-bottom: 0%; } .tx4-medium { display: block; font-size: medium; text-indent: 0%; margin-top: 2%; margin-bottom: 2%; } .tx4-large { display: block; font-size: large; text-indent: 0%; margin-top: 2%; margin-bottom: 2%; } .tx4-x-large { display: block; font-size: x-large; text-indent: 0%; margin-top: 2%; margin-bottom: 2%; } .tx4-xx-large { display: block; font-size: xx-large; text-indent: 0%; margin-top: 2%; margin-bottom: 2%; } .tx { display: block; font-size: small; text-indent: 5%; margin-top: 0%; margin-bottom: 0%; } .txa { display: block; font-size: x-small; text-indent: 5%; margin-top: 0%; margin-bottom: 0%; } .tx-medium { display: block; font-size: medium; text-indent: 5%; margin-top: 0%; margin-bottom: 0%; } .tx-large { display: block; font-size: large; text-indent: 5%; margin-top: 0%; margin-bottom: 0%; } .tx-x-large { display: block; font-size: x-large; text-indent: 5%; margin-top: 0%; margin-bottom: 0%; } .tx-xx-large { display: block; font-size: xx-large; text-indent: 5%; margin-top: 0%; margin-bottom: 0%; } .txb13 { display: block; font-size: small;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.txb13-medium { display: block; font-size: medium;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.txb13-large { display: block; font-size: large;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.txb13-x-large { display: block; font-size: x-large;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.txb13-xx-large { display: block; font-size: xx-large;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.tx12 { display: block; font-size: small; text-indent: 5%; margin-top: 2%; margin-bottom: 0%; } .tx12-medium { display: block; font-size: medium; text-indent: 5%; margin-top: 2%; margin-bottom: 0%; } .tx12-large { display: block; font-size: large; text-indent: 5%; margin-top: 2%; margin-bottom: 0%; } .tx12-x-large { display: block; font-size: x-large; text-indent: 5%; margin-top: 2%; margin-bottom: 0%; } .tx12-xx-large { display: block; font-size: xx-large; text-indent: 5%; margin-top: 2%; margin-bottom: 0%; } .tx13 { display: block; font-size: small;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.tx13-medium { display: block; font-size: medium;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.tx13-large { display: block; font-size: large;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.tx13-x-large { display: block; font-size: x-large;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.tx13-xx-large { display: block; font-size: xx-large; text-indent: 5%; margin-top: 0%; margin-bottom: 2%; } .tx14 { display: block; font-size: small; text-indent: 5%; margin-top: 2%; margin-bottom: 3%; } .tx14-medium { display: block; font-size: medium; text-indent: 5%; margin-top: 2%; margin-bottom: 3%; } .tx14-large { display: block; font-size: large; text-indent: 5%; margin-top: 2%; margin-bottom: 3%; } .tx14-x-large { display: block; font-size: x-large; text-indent: 5%; margin-top: 2%; margin-bottom: 3%; } .tx14-xx-large { display: block; font-size: xx-large; text-indent: 5%; margin-top: 2%; margin-bottom: 3%; } .break { page-break-before: always; } .hang { display: block; font-size: small; margin-left: 2.8%; text-indent: -2.5%; margin-top: 0%; margin-bottom: 0%; } .hanga { display: block; font-size: small; padding-left: 4.5% ; text-indent: -3.5% ; margin-top: 0%; margin-bottom: 0%; } .hang1 { display: block; font-size: small; margin-left: 1.8% ; text-indent: -1.8% ; margin-top: 2%; margin-bottom: 0%; } .hang1a { display: block; font-size: small; margin-left: 1.8em; text-indent: -1.8em; margin-top: 0.5%; margin-bottom: 0%; } .hang2 { display: block; font-size: small; padding-left: 2% ; text-indent: -2% ; margin-top: 0%; margin-bottom: 0%; } .hang3 { display: block; font-size: small; padding-left: 8.5% ; text-indent: -3.5% ; margin-top: 0%; margin-bottom: 3%; } .txb { display: block; font-size: small;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 0%; } .txb-medium { display: block; font-size: medium;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 0%; } .txb-large { display: block; font-size: large;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 0%; } .txb-x-large { display: block; font-size: x-large;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 0%; } .txb-xx-large { display: block; font-size: xx-large;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 0%; } .txb1 { display: block; font-size: small;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 3%; } .txb1-medium { display: block; font-size: medium;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 3%; } .txb1-large { display: block; font-size: large;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 3%; } .txb1-x-large { display: block; font-size: x-large;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 3%; } .txb1-xx-large { display: block; font-size: xx-large; text-indent: 0%; margin-left: 5%; margin-top: 0%; margin-bottom: 3%; } .right { display: block; text-align: right; font-size: small; margin-top: 0%; margin-bottom: 0%; } .right-medium { display: block; text-align: right; font-size: medium; margin-top: 0%; margin-bottom: 0%; } .right-large { display: block; text-align: right; font-size: large; margin-top: 0%; margin-bottom: 0%; } .right-x-large { display: block; text-align: right; font-size: x-large; margin-top: 0%; margin-bottom: 0%; } .right-xx-large { display: block; text-align: right; font-size: xx-large; margin-top: 0%; margin-bottom: 0%; } .right1 { display: block; text-align: right; font-size: small; margin-top: 2%; margin-bottom: 2%; } .right1-medium { display: block; text-align: right; font-size: medium; margin-top: 2%; margin-bottom: 2%; } .right1-large { display: block; text-align: right; font-size: large; margin-top: 2%; margin-bottom: 2%; } .right1-x-large { display: block; text-align: right; font-size: x-large; margin-top: 2%; margin-bottom: 2%; } .right1-xx-large { display: block; text-align: right; font-size: xx-large; margin-top: 2%; margin-bottom: 2%; } .right2 { display: block; text-align: right; font-size: small; margin-top: 2%; margin-bottom: 0%; } .right2-medium { display: block; text-align: right; font-size: medium; margin-top: 2%; margin-bottom: 0%; } .right2-large { display: block; text-align: right; font-size: large; margin-top: 2%; margin-bottom: 0%; } .right2-x-large { display: block; text-align: right; font-size: x-large; margin-top: 2%; margin-bottom: 0%; } .right2-xx-large { display: block; text-align: right; font-size: xx-large; margin-top: 2%; margin-bottom: 0%; } .right3 { display: block; text-align: right; font-size: small; margin-top: 0%; margin-bottom: 2%; } .right3-medium { display: block; text-align: right; font-size: medium; margin-top: 0%; margin-bottom: 2%; } .right3-large { display: block; text-align: right; font-size: large; margin-top: 0%; margin-bottom: 2%; } .right3-x-large { display: block; text-align: right; font-size: x-large; margin-top: 0%; margin-bottom: 2%; } .right3-xx-large { display: block; text-align: right; font-size: xx-large; margin-top: 0%; margin-bottom: 2%; } .big { font-size: xx-large; } .cap { display: block; font-size: small; text-align: left; text-indent: 0%; margin-top: 1%; margin-bottom: 2%; } .h1 { display: block; font-weight: bold; text-align: left; font-size: large; text-indent: 0%; margin-top: 2%; margin-bottom: 2%; color: #394B8B; } .h1a { display: block; font-weight: bold; text-align: left; font-size: large; text-indent: 0%; margin-top: 2%; margin-bottom: 2%; color: #231F20; } .h2 { display: block; font-weight: bold; font-size: medium; text-indent: 0%; text-align: left; margin-top: 2%; margin-bottom: 0%; } .h2a { display: block; font-weight: bold; font-size: medium; text-indent: 0%; text-align: left; margin-top: 2%; margin-bottom: 1%; color: #394B7D; } .h3 { display: block; font-weight: bold; font-size: medium; text-indent: -2.8em; margin-left: 2.8em; text-align: left; margin-top: 2%; margin-bottom: 1%; color: #394B8B; } .pic { color: #EA7C1E; } div.line { border-bottom: 1pt solid black; padding-bottom: 2px; margin-top: 0%; margin-bottom: 0%; } div.line1 { border-bottom: 1pt solid black; padding-bottom: 2px; border-color: #A03722; margin-top: 0%; margin-bottom: 0%; } .ack { display: block; font-size: 1.5em; margin-left: 0%; text-align: left; margin-top: 2%; font-weight: bold; margin-bottom: 2%; } .bol { color: #FFFFFF; font-weight: bold; background-color: #394B8B; text-align: center; font-size: 1em; padding-left: 8px; padding-right: 8px; padding-top: 1px; padding-bottom: 1px; } .blu { color: #394B7D; } .ser-1 { display: block; text-align: center; font-size: small; margin-top: 0%; margin-bottom: 0%; } .h2-a { display: block; font-weight: bold; font-size: medium; text-indent: 0%; text-align: left; margin-top: 0%; margin-bottom: 0%; }